Aviation Electrification Technologies: UK Job Market Outlook
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Aircraft Electrification Engineer (Primary: Electrification, Secondary: Aircraft Systems) | Design, develop, and test electrical systems for electric and hybrid-electric aircraft. High demand for expertise in power electronics and motor control. |
| Battery Systems Technician (Primary: Battery, Secondary: Maintenance) | Specialize in the installation, maintenance, and repair of aircraft battery systems, crucial for the growing electric aviation sector. |
| Electric Power System Integrator (Primary: Power Systems, Secondary: Integration) | Integrate various electrical components into the aircraft's overall power system, ensuring optimal performance and reliability. Experience with high-voltage systems is essential. |
| Aviation Electrification Project Manager (Primary: Project Management, Secondary: Electrification) | Lead and manage projects related to the development and implementation of electric aviation technologies. Strong organizational and leadership skills are key. |
